Spacious 2LDK Apartment in Tokyo's Prestigious Bunkyo Ward
This well-maintained apartment, built in August 1998, offers a generous living space of 78.42 sqm (approximately 23.72 tsubo) in the highly desirable Bunkyo ward of Tokyo. Located on the 3rd floor of a 9-story reinforced concrete building, the unit features a 2LDK layout with a 5.6-tatami Western-style room, a 7.6-tatami Western-style room, and a spacious 19.2-tatami combined living, dining, and kitchen area. A 7.22 sqm balcony with a southwest-facing orientation provides pleasant natural light and views.
The property is equipped with numerous amenities for comfortable modern living. These include a system kitchen, air conditioning in all rooms, floor heating, a bathroom with drying and heating functions, a shower-equipped vanity, a washlet toilet, and ample storage including walk-in closets. Building-wide features include an auto-lock security system with monitor, double-lock doors, security cameras, 24-hour security, an elevator, a delivery box, and parking and bicycle parking facilities. The building is managed by a condominium association with a full-time, daytime superintendent.
Translated from the agent's notes, the property is situated in a quiet residential area with no building directly in front, ensuring an open view and a lack of oppressive feeling from neighboring houses. The special notes indicate an owner change is scheduled, and the property is currently tenanted with an annual projected rental income of 3.96 million yen and a yield of 3.04%. The lease contract runs from January 31, 2025, to January 30, 2028. The remarks also confirm the property has a defect insurance guarantee and performance evaluation.
The apartment is conveniently located within the school district for Bunkyo Ward's Kubomachi Elementary School. The area is known for its academic atmosphere, being home to several prestigious universities. A notable nearby landmark is the Koishikawa Korakuen Gardens, one of Tokyo's oldest and most beautiful traditional Japanese landscape gardens, offering a serene escape just a short distance away.
